2018年10月16日 ※2この他、Ruby、Python、JAVA、C#、Node.jsが使用できるようです。 Selenium-webDriverサイトからChromeブラウザ用のWebDriverをダウンロードします。 WebDriverとはサイトの IllustratorでPDFのファイルサイズを軽くしよう!
テストエビデンス取得自動化の秘技(前編):Selenium VBAを使って自動でブラウザーを操作してスクショをExcelに張り付けてみた (4/4) Webサイトを Selenium APIを目的別に紹介します(Selenium RCのAPIは除く)。言語別にそれぞれ使い方ページにリンクが張られており目的別に利用したいメソッドを探すことが出来ます。 2017/07/20 2015/11/15 Selenium(Pythonにて使用)でエラー Seleniumでクローリングする環境を構築する際にchromedriverがある場所を指定してあげないとエラーになる場合があったのでメモ。(以前は何もしなくてもいけたような^^; 今回作った環境では発生。 2017/08/14
はじめに DI部のおおたきです。Headless ChromeがWindowsをサポートしたのでWindows上で動かしてみました。 環境 Windows7 Google Chrome 62.0.3202.75 Pyth … selenium; six; urllib WEBDriverのインストール seleniumでWEBブラウザを操作するには、各ブラウザに対応するWEBDriverをインストールしておく必要があります。 今回は、Google Chrome と Edgeの2つのインストール方法です。 Chrome用ドライバのインストールと環境設定 import chromedriver_binary from selenium import webdriver options = webdriver.ChromeOptions() # chromeの実行ファイルが格納されているパスを指定する。 標準のChromeの使用であれば特に設定は必要ないが、Canaryを指定したい場合は必要な項目 # Macの場合こんな感じみたい。 例えば、テストでファイルをWebアプリケーションにアップロードする必要がある場合、リモートWebDriverは実行時にローカルマシンからリモートWebサーバーにファイルを自動的に転送できます。 Aug 14, 2017 · 「2017年夏、ブラウザテストフレームワーク」の続き。 ServiceNowアプリケーションのブラウザテストをしたくて色々調べている。 前回は、フレームワークにWebdriverIOを使うと決めたところまで書いた。 今回、最終的に、WebdriverIO、WDIO、selenium-standalone、Jasmineと、Chromeのヘッドレスモードを使って Selenium Grid Server(Hub)と同様にNodeとなる端末に selenium-server-standalone-2.45.0.jarをダウンロードします。 jsonでNodeの設定ファイルを作成します。 設定ファイルにはブラウザの種類とGridのURLを記載して、ファイル名をnode.jsonとして上記jarと同じディレクトリに保存し Selenium WebDriver Python. ChromeDriverでファイルダウンロードするSelenium Seleniumスクリプトをdocker上のHeadless Chromeで動かす
Install Chrome Driver (Win32, macOS, and Linux64) for Selenium WebDriver into your Unit Test Project. "chromedriver(.exe)" is copied to bin folder from package folder when the build process. NuGet package restoring ready, and no need to commit "chromedriver(.exe)" binary into source code control repository. / Selenium WebDriver用 Chrome Driver (Win32, macOS, 及び Linux64) を単体テスト 前回記事「NodeJS+Seleniumを使った画像ダウンロードで困ったこと(2)」を書いた後で、実践 Selenium WebDriverにざっと目を通していたところ、新展開がありました。特に、ログイン後にアクセスできる画像を、nodeで直接ダウンロードできるようになりました(最後の方に書かれています)。画像 Selenium IDE. Selenium IDE is a Chrome and Firefox plugin which records and plays back user interactions with the browser. Use this to either create simple scripts or assist in exploratory testing. Download latest released version for Chrome or for Firefox or view the Release Notes. Download previous IDE versions here. 【Python】Seleniumを使ってファイルをダウンロードする方法です。PythonのSeleniumをインストールされていない方は【Python】Seleniumのインストール方法を御覧ください。 TypeScript、WebdriverIO、Seleniumで自動テスト環境を構築し、テストを自動化していきましょう。 自動テスト環境を整備することで、リグレッションテストが効率化され、新規開発に注力できるようになっていきます。 普段よく触っているNode.jsを使って作ろうと思います。 webdriverのダウンロード(パスも通しておく) npm install selenium-webdriver node-cache request; Uniposにログインして、送り主のID、メッセージボディ、受け取り主のIDを取得するスクリプトを組む Node.js:8.11.4; selenium-webdriver:4.0.0-alpha.5 これで npm run mocha ファイル名.js 今回はChromeを選択。 ダウンロード後、解凍し
2018年10月16日 ※2この他、Ruby、Python、JAVA、C#、Node.jsが使用できるようです。 Selenium-webDriverサイトからChromeブラウザ用のWebDriverをダウンロードします。 WebDriverとはサイトの IllustratorでPDFのファイルサイズを軽くしよう! 2015年5月10日 ・Firefox:36.0 ・Chrome:42.0. □ テストスクリプト実行サーバ・OS:CentOS6.6 64bit ・ruby:2.1.1 ・Rails:4.1.1 ・Bundler:1.7.12 の立て方. まず、Hubにしたいサーバに以下のURLからselenium-server-standalone-2.45.0.jarをダウンロードします。 を作成します。 設定ファイルにはブラウザの種類とGridのURLを記載して、ファイル名をnode.jsonとして上記jarと同じディレクトリに保存します。 Selenium WebDriverを動かそうとすると、「Unable to get browser」というエラーが発生します。 2019年3月13日 Chromeのドライバーはヘッドレスクロームを使うために必要です。以下のリンクから実行ファイル入りのフォルダをダウンロードできるようです。わたしはもっていたので確認してません。 Downloads – ChromeDriver – WebDriver for Chrome. 必要なライブラリのインポートimport time from selenium import webdriver # Chromeブラウザを起動するdriver = webdriver. 開発実績としては、業務自動化ツール(在庫管理・発注・ファイル操作 etc)、電子カルテシステム、ロボット用プログラムなどが 2017年10月30日 ローカルPC内でブラウザの自動テストを実行する場合、karma-chrome-launcher が、現在のkarmaの実行環境に Internet Explorer用のWebDriverはseleniumで開発・提供し、Firefox、Chrome、Safariなどはベンダーが実装 Selenium Standalone Serverをダウンロードして、目的のパスに位置させます。 Hubサーバーが実行されるポートを変更するなどの設定は、コマンドラインオプション、またはJSONファイルで定義します。参考 npm scriptから、マルチブラウザテストを実行してみよう。
2017年11月1日 coding: utf-8 -*- from selenium import webdriver from selenium.webdriver.chrome.options import Options ているChromeのパスを指定します。 executable_path は先ほどダウンロードしたWebDirverのパスを指定します。 最後にスクリーンショットを取ったファイルは実行したpythonファイルと同階層に作成されます。